ANTEGRADE COLONIC INSTILLATION APPARATUS

1. An instillation apparatus for the purpose of pumping fluid into the intestinal tract through a stoma opening as presented by a patient, comprising,a fluid reservoir having a housing, a top and a bottom suitable for holding instillation fluid, the bottom being a bulkhead plate,an internal component chamber having housing, a top and a bottom wherein the chamber top is the bulkhead plate of the fluid reservoir, the bottom having a base with a cavity for holding a battery power supply,a pump assembly having an electric pump motor, drive transfer and pump manifold with the pump manifold having a pump cavity, an inlet and an outlet, mounted from below through an opening in bottom of the fluid reservoir and inside the internal component chamber with the inlet in direct fluid communication with the fluid reservoir and the outlet protruding upwardly into the fluid reservoir but not in fluid communication with the reservoir,a delivery tube being flexible and having a proximate and distal end with the proximate end in direct fluid communication with the pump manifold outlet,a catheter suitable for insertion into a patient with an intestinal stoma constructed for purposes of instilling fluid into a patient'"'"'s intestines in direct fluid communication and removably attached to the distal end of the delivery tube,a pump control module communicatively attached to the pump motor for purposes of activation, and mounted in the internal component chamber,a fluid recess chamber being formed as an expansion of the pump manifold inlet having a top, height, wall, bottom, filter in the top in direct fluid communication with the fluid reservoir, and a draw tube positioned vertically and a top end positioned near and below the filter and having a drain hole tangent to the bottom of the recess chamber with the draw tube in direct fluid communication with the pump cavity,a fluid level sensor mounted in the fluid recess chamber wall operable to communicate the presence of fluid in the chamber to the pump control module to which it is communicatively attached, the pump control module further being in direct electrical communication with the battery power supply;

  • and,a user control panel mounted proximate to the internal component chamber being in direct electrical communication with the pump control module.
